From 07460d167d0ed84b1a7b52135434a23ee6a4f018 Mon Sep 17 00:00:00 2001 From: Daniel Teske Date: Wed, 28 Mar 2012 14:57:52 +0200 Subject: [PATCH] ProjectExplorerPlugin:addProject() remove code to set startup project addProject() is called from 2 places: openProject and restoreSession openProject() takes care of setting a startup project itself and restoreSession sets it explicitly after opening the projects. So the code in addProject() is not needed. Change-Id: Iaa5de3e36fd4b60c8ceb79b8ea3ca68dbc9b491c Reviewed-by: Daniel Teske --- src/plugins/projectexplorer/session.cpp | 5 ----- 1 file changed, 5 deletions(-) diff --git a/src/plugins/projectexplorer/session.cpp b/src/plugins/projectexplorer/session.cpp index ff2924ac500..1b5d5905118 100644 --- a/src/plugins/projectexplorer/session.cpp +++ b/src/plugins/projectexplorer/session.cpp @@ -285,11 +285,6 @@ void SessionManager::addProjects(const QList &projects) if (clearedList.count() == 1) emit singleProjectAdded(clearedList.first()); - - // maybe we have a new startup project? - if (!startupProject()) - if (!m_projects.isEmpty()) - setStartupProject(m_projects.first()); } void SessionManager::removeProject(Project *project)